A Cambridge man is being called a hero and now has an award to back that up.
Ryan Smyth pulled a man from a burning car in Melbourne, Australia in 2012.
The Galt native was recognized this week with Australia’s top bravery award.
The Record reports Smyth was one of 26 people officially recognized by their governor general.
He will be back for a visit to Cambridge in a few months.
